Tractor Coloring Pages is a kids coloring game with tractors. You can select one of twelve images with tractors in it and color it. On the right side of the game screen, you can find different colors. Click on it to use them. On the left side of the game screen, you can change the brush size. If you color a smaller area you will need to small the brush size. When you do some mistakes you can use an eraser to erase the error. So, Click play select the image, and start to color. You can save the image when you are done with coloring. Use the image later as you wish.
